When I load the official MediaSoup Demo in Safari, with a room of several people (around 15 people), the webpage is crashing in about 90% of the times. This happens after allowing to use the microphone, but before allowing to use the camera. The browser console doesn't show any errors.
In about 10% of the times, everything works perfectly.

These are the information I found so far:

- This only happens with Safari, if I use Chrome, it's always working.
- The crash doesn't happen if no other people are in the room.

Steps to reproduce:

1. Enter a room on https://v3demo.mediasoup.org/?roomId=k1vnakp4 with 15 people, e.g. by opening the same room link in 15 browser tabs in Chrome.
2. Now enter the same room with Safari on an arbitrary device.
3. Allow to use the microphone.
4. The webpage will be reloaded and the error "This webpage was reloaded because a problem occured." is shown.
5. Click on allow to use the microphone again.
6. The page is crashing completely and the error "A problem repeatedly occured with https://v3demo.mediasoup.org/?roomId=owhaa7lq" is shown.
